Therma-Tru Introduces Variety of New Door and Glass Options at 2014 NAHB International Builders’ Show®

MAUMEE, OHIO – Attendees at the 2014 NAHB International Builders’ Show® will be the first in the country to view new products launched by Therma-Tru Corp. for 2014. An assortment of new doors, features and glass styles are being offered to provide builders and remodelers with enhanced options for increasing their business.

Located in booth C6108 at the trade show in Las Vegas from February 4-6, 2014, the Therma-Tru exhibit includes an expansion of the Pulse® and Fiber-Classic® Mahogany CollectionTM product lines, redesign of internal blinds with Low-E glass and expanded options for simulated divided lites and grilles between the glass. A new camber top glass shape, more decorative glass options and an improved formula for the Same-Day® Stain and topcoat will also be launched at the show.

New Products for 2014

Fiber-Classic Mahogany Collection - On-trend new door styles expand this top-selling, growing product line to satisfy homeowners. New doors and sidelites include deep Mahogany graining and high-definition panel embossments that are designed to complement rich wood tones in the home's interior, extending the hardwood look to entry, patio, house-to-garage and service doors. The expansion also introduces the Mahogany grain to the Therma-Tru vented sidelite offering.

Pulse – Launched in 2013, the Pulse series of contemporary doors now adds a Mahogany-grained fiberglass option along with a new Echo design option for doors and sidelites. Delivering clean lines and crisp right angles, Pulse meets new construction and remodeling market needs for homeowners seeking modern and eclectic entrances.

The new Mahogany-grained fiberglass offering joins the original Oak-grained fiberglass,

smooth fiberglass and steel product line options. New configurations within the Echo design provide a total of 12 new door styles and four new sidelite choices available in a variety of glass designs and material offerings. Pulse doors and sidelites are available in 6'8" and 8'0" heights.

Internal Blinds - Available in full- and half-lite styles, ENERGY STAR® qualified Low-E internal blinds provide both energy efficiency and privacy to home entrances. Cordless operation allows homeowners to control the desired level of light and privacy with the simplicity of a single handle. Blinds are enclosed between glass and remain dust-free for homeowner convenience.

Available in the Fiber-Classic Mahogany CollectionTM, Fiber-Classic® Oak Collection®, Smooth-Star®, ProfilesTM, Traditions and Pulse product lines for doors and sidelites.

Camber Top Glass Shape - Available for Fiber-Classic Mahogany and Oak Collections, Smooth-Star, Profiles and Traditions doors, the camber top glass shape combines the beauty and natural light of glass with the sense of security that comes with the privacy of a solid-panel door at an exceptional value. Designed as a solution for budget-conscious homeowners, the camber top is designed to complement wood-grained, stainable and smooth, paintable doors for broad appeal.

Decorative glass designs of Maple Park®, SaratogaTM, WellesleyTM and ConcordeTM are available in a variety of caming options to suit many aesthetics. Four privacy glass designs are also available for the camber top, as well as Low-E and clear glass. Divided lite options include grilles between glass in five colors (white, almond, bronze, tan and stone), as well as fixed grille configurations.

Simulated Divided Lites (SDLs) - More than 400 different SDL configurations are now available with the addition of new grid patterns designed to pair with privacy, Low-E and clear glass, as well as flush-glazed products. SDLs are also designed to be layered over GBGs to create a more authentic divided lite look.

Made of durable composite material, wood-grained and smooth-textured SDLs can be stained and painted to complement doors and sidelites, enhancing the overall look of Colonial and Craftsman style homes. Available in the Fiber-Classic Mahogany and Oak Collections, Smooth-Star, Profiles and Traditions product lines.

Grilles Between Glass (GBGs) - The Therma-Tru GBG portfolio expands to create up to 3,000 different configurations with the addition of new colors, shapes and grid patterns. The easy-to-maintain divided lite option complements a variety of home styles including Traditional-, Craftsman- and Prairie-inspired looks while meeting homeowner desires by coordinating with window grid patterns and colors.

GBGs can be customized with contour or flat bars and five color options (white, almond, bronze, tan and stone) to complement both wood-grained, stainable and smooth, paintable doors and sidelites. Grilles are thermally sealed between two panes of tempered glass and are available in the Fiber-Classic Mahogany and Oak Collections, Smooth-Star, Profiles and Traditions product lines.

CambridgeTM Decorative Glass with Black Nickel Caming - As black nickel caming continues to grow in popularity with homeowners, Therma-Tru extends the option to Cambridge decorative glass for the Classic-Craft® Rustic CollectionTM, Classic-Craft® Oak CollectionTM and Classic-Craft® Canvas Collection®. Available in a wide variety of glass shapes for both entry doors and sidelites.

Impact-Rated Salinas® Glass Design with Oceana Glass - Impact-rated Salinas decorative glass is now available with textured Oceana glass instead of clear glass for increased privacy. A variety of popular door styles meet coastal region codes and regulations, offering enhanced protection in extreme weather conditions while providing added security.** Available in the Fiber-Classic Mahogany and Oak Collections, Smooth-Star, Profiles and Traditions product lines for doors and sidelites.

Same-Day Stain Kits - The newly-formulated, easy-to-use stain and topcoat provide increased workability and reduced gloss in a quick-drying formula. Specially formulated for Therma-Tru® fiberglass doors and Fypon® stainable polyurethane products, the colorfast stain resists fading, bleaching and yellowing to create a beautiful finish and is available in seven finish colors: Light Oak, Natural Oak, Walnut, English Walnut, Mahogany, Cedar and Cherry.

Same-Day Stain is available in an all-inclusive kit that contains everything needed to stain a Therma-Tru fiberglass double door system, a single door with two sidelites, or approximately 50 square feet of Fypon stainable polyurethane. Assorted individual-sized cans of stain and topcoat are also available.

About Therma-Tru

Therma-Tru is the nation’s leading manufacturer and most preferred brand of entry doors. Founded in 1962, Therma-Tru pioneered the fiberglass entry door industry, and today offers a complete portfolio of entry and patio door system solutions, including decorative glass doorlites, sidelites and transoms, and door components. The company also offers low-maintenance Fypon urethane and PVC products. Headquartered in Maumee, Ohio, Therma-Tru is part of Fortune Brands Home & Security, Inc. (NYSE: FBHS).
